Drama
The streets of Margate are 97% White. Its Black residents, make up just 0.5% of a population of 65,000. Inspired by award-winning artist Barbara Walker’s Turner Contemporary exhibition 'Place, Space and Who' exploring the lives of marginalised Black women in Margate, 0.5% looks at excerpts of the lives of Black people thriving and surviving in a community, and the fleeting but powerful connection between them. On a single day in Margate, the sheer existence of four strangers brings joy and comfort to a group of individuals living in the area, and their experiences interlink: Jide, an 81-year-old man who has called Kent home for the last sixty years. Falle, a young father and musician. Kanndiss, who practices self-care through movement. And lastly teenage Shianna, who wonders what lies beyond her small town.
